The Size and Layout of the House


The size and layout of the container house play a significant role in determining the overall cost of construction. A 3500 sq ft house is relatively large and will require multiple shipping containers to build. The more containers you utilize, the higher the expense will be. Additionally, the design and layout of the house can impact the complexity and cost of the construction process. Customizations such as additional floors, balconies, or unique architectural features may add to the overall cost.


When planning the layout, it's important to consider the number of rooms, bathrooms, and common spaces you require. Are you looking to build a multi-story house or a sprawling single-level home? These factors will influence the number of containers needed, the amount of materials required, and consequently, the total cost.


Foundation and Site Preparation


Before constructing the container house, it's crucial to prepare the site properly. This includes leveling the ground, ensuring proper drainage, and laying a solid foundation. Depending on the site's characteristics and the local building codes, the foundation could be a traditional concrete slab, concrete piers, or a raised steel framework.


The foundation is a critical component of the house's stability and durability. It provides a solid base for the containers and helps distribute the load evenly. The cost of the foundation will vary depending on the type of foundation chosen and the site's conditions. Therefore, it's important to consult with professionals during the planning phase to determine the most suitable foundation for your container house.


Electrical and Plumbing Installations


Like any traditional house, container houses require electrical and plumbing installations to function properly. These systems play a crucial role in providing power, lighting, heating, cooling, and water supply to the house. The cost of electrical and plumbing installations will depend on factors such as the complexity of the design, the number of fixtures and outlets, and the distance from the main power and water sources.


It's essential to hire qualified professionals for the electrical and plumbing work to ensure compliance with local building codes and safety regulations. They will evaluate your specific requirements and provide an accurate estimate of the cost associated with these installations. Planning the layout and placement of electrical outlets, switches, and plumbing fixtures in advance can help minimize any additional costs or modifications during the construction phase.


Insulation and Climate Control


Proper insulation is a key aspect of container house construction, especially when it comes to maintaining a comfortable indoor climate. Insulation helps regulate the temperature inside the house, keeping it warm in colder climates and cool in hotter regions. Insulation also improves soundproofing, reducing noise from outside.


The cost of insulation will depend on the type of insulation material chosen, such as spray foam, rigid foam board, or fiberglass. Each material has its own advantages and price points. Additionally, considering the local climate is important when selecting insulation, as certain areas may require higher R-values to achieve optimal energy efficiency.


Climate control systems, such as heating, ventilation, and air conditioning (HVAC), are also essential for a container house. These systems ensure that the indoor temperature remains pleasant throughout the year. The cost of HVAC installations will depend on the size of the house, the desired temperature zones, and the energy efficiency of the chosen system.


Interior and Exterior Finishes


The final cost of building a container house includes the interior and exterior finishes. This encompasses the materials used for flooring, walls, ceilings, windows, doors, and roofing. The choice of finishes will significantly impact the overall aesthetic appeal of the house and its durability over time.


For the interior, you can choose from a variety of materials such as hardwood flooring, laminate, tile, or polished concrete, depending on your budget and design preferences. Walls can be finished with drywall, plywood, or specialized coatings. Ceilings can be completed using drywall, acoustic panels, or exposed container ceilings for an industrial look.


Exterior finishes can range from simple painting to cladding the containers with materials such as wood, metal, or fiber cement siding. Each finish option will have its own cost implications, affecting the final budget of the project.
